Compare Amarillo to Balch Springs

This post compares Amarillo, Texas to Balch Springs, Texas across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Amarillo (city) Balch Springs (city)
Population 197,823 25,236
Income (median) $39,715 $32,430
Home Value (median) $123,200 $85,900
White 82% 71%
Black 6% 21%
Asian 3% 0%
With Kids 35% 54%
Age (median) 33 26
Rentals 38% 39%
